Rio Tinto announces total dividend of 557 US cents per share for 2020, a 72% pay-out, from robust results during a challenging year

Key Points: 
  • Strong safety performance in 2020, fatality-free for a second year in a row, with the all injury frequency rate improving to 0.37.
  • We are working to restore trust with the Puutu Kunti Kurrama and Pinikura (PKKP) people following the Juukan Gorge events.
  • $15.9 billion net cash generated from operating activities was 6% higher than 2019 primarily driven by higher iron ore prices and stability in operating performance.
  • $9.0 billion full-year dividend, equivalent to 557 US cents per share and 72% of underlying earnings, includes $5.0 billion record final ordinary dividend (309 US cents per share) and $1.5 billion special dividend (93 US cents per share) declared today.
